📊 Market Shift: Negative Funding Rates Signal a Structural Bearish Phase

A notable shift is unfolding across the crypto derivatives landscape. Funding rates on major perpetual contracts—including Bitcoin and Ethereum—have remained consistently negative for several days. More importantly, Bitcoin’s cumulative funding rate has now turned negative for the first time this quarter, highlighting a deeper structural transition rather than a short-term pullback.

This is not an isolated move. Altcoins such as BNB, SOL, and DOGE are also experiencing sustained negative funding environments. The alignment across major assets suggests that bearish sentiment is no longer selective—it has become a market-wide positioning strategy.

📉 Understanding the Signal

Negative funding rates indicate that short traders are paying long traders, reflecting a dominant bearish bias. What makes this phase more critical is the stability of open interest (OI) despite declining prices. This signals active short buildup rather than simple long liquidations—traders are confidently positioning for further downside.

⚠️ Why It Matters

The combination of negative funding rates and elevated OI creates a crowded short environment, which historically leads to two potential outcomes:

• Trend Continuation: If macro conditions remain weak, bearish momentum may persist as shorts maintain control.
• Short Squeeze Setup: Overcrowded shorts increase the probability of a sharp upside move triggered by even a minor positive catalyst, forcing rapid liquidations.

🔍 Current Market Context

Funding rates remain mildly negative across exchanges, while volatility stays relatively compressed. This indicates a positioning phase rather than panic-driven capitulation—often a precursor to significant directional movement.
